Dr. Kris Describes the Genetic Mutation Screening Study
Author(s)Mark G. Kris, MD, FASCO
Dr. Mark Kris from MSKCC Describes the Genetic Mutation Screening Multicenter Study
Advertisement
Mark G. Kris, MD, chief of the Thoracic Oncology Service at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Center, describes the genetic mutation screening multicenter study that he was the lead author for and presented at the 2011 annual meeting of the American Society of Clinical Oncology.
